What are some common challenges Contract Writers face when working with multiple clients simultaneously?

Contract Writers often work with several clients at once, which can present challenges such as managing conflicting deadlines, adapting to different writing styles or brand voices, and balancing workload priorities. Staying organized with project management tools and maintaining clear communication with clients are essential to ensure timely delivery and consistent quality. Additionally, Contract Writers must be adept at quickly understanding new subject matter and client expectations, which helps them deliver tailored content efficiently.

What are contract writers?

Contract writers are professionals who specialize in drafting, reviewing, and editing legal agreements and contracts. They ensure that contracts are clear, legally sound, and tailored to the specific needs of the parties involved. Contract writers often work with businesses, law firms, or individuals to create documents for employment, sales, partnerships, and other agreements. Their expertise helps prevent misunderstandings and protects the interests of all parties by making sure the contract complies with relevant laws. They may also advise on contract terms and negotiate on behalf of their clients.

SUMMARY
The Contract Manager is responsible for drafting, reviewing, negotiating, and managing all contracts-including owner agreements, subcontracts, purchase orders, change orders, and industrial service agreements. This role ensures that every project is executed under clear, enforceable, and commercially sound terms.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ES

  1. Review, draft, and negotiate owner contracts, subcontracts, and industrial service agreements
  2. Identify and mitigate contractual, financial, and operational risks
  3. Ensure compliance with insurance, bonding, indemnity, and safety requirements
  4. Support project teams with change order strategy, claims documentation, and dispute resolution
  5. Maintain contract templates, clause libraries, and standardized terms
  6. Coordinate with legal counsel on complex or high-risk agreements
  7. Manage contract logs, amendments, and document control
  8. Support pre-construction with RFP reviews, scope development, and bid clarifications
  9. Ensure compliance with state, federal, and industrial owner requirements
  10. Lead internal training on contract best practices and risk awareness

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Construction Management, Engineering, Business, or related field
  • 5-10 years of experience in construction contracting, project management, or procurement
  • Understanding of MEP systems, industrial construction, and subcontractor workflows
  • Proven experience negotiating owner agreements and subcontract terms
  • Ability to interpret plans, specs, scopes, and technical documents
  • Strong knowledge of risk management, insurance, indemnity, and bonding
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• High attention to detail and strong organizational discipline

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ience with industrial owner-direct contracts (manufacturing, energy, process facilities)
  • Experience with large-scale MEP subcontracting
  • Certifications such as:
    • CPCM (Certified Professional Contract Manager)
    • CCCM (Certified Commercial Contract Manager)
    • CCCA (Certified Construction Contract Administrator)
  • Familiarity with FAR/DFARS, public procurement, or government contracting
  • Experience supporting claims, disputes, or schedule-impact documentation
